About the Role

We are seeking a highly skilled and detail-oriented Financial Controller to own and lead our financial operations and support strategic decision-making as we continue to expand our business.

The Financial Controller will be responsible for financial reporting, budgeting, forecasting, internal controls, and financial analysis to support key business decisions. This role reports directly to the CEO and works closely with the agency's leadership team to provide financial insight, clarity, and operational discipline.

This is a hands-on, senior individual contributor role with leadership responsibility. This role is ideal for someone who thrives in a fast-paced, entrepreneurial environment and enjoys being close to the numbers while helping shape how the business scales.

What you get to do
  • Financial Management & Reporting
  • Prepare accurate monthly and annual financial statements in accordance with ASPE.
  • Analyze financial results, compare with budget, and provide insights and recommendations for improvements.
  • Prepare and present financial reporting packages and summaries for the CEO.
  • Own and directly execute core accounting functions, including AR/AP, payroll, adjusting journal entries, month-end close, and related reconciliations.
  • Plan and manage cash flow to ensure sufficient liquidity for day-to-day operations.
  • Oversee the accounts receivable and payable processes, ensuring timely collections and payments.
  • Lead the annual budgeting and forecasting process, including variance analysis and scenario planning.
  • Process Improvement & Internal Controls
  • Develop and implement scalable financial processes, controls, and systems to ensure processes and internal controls are effective and efficient as the business continues to grow and expand.
  • Ensure compliance with regulatory requirements, tax laws, and corporate policies.
  • Work closely with external accountants to facilitate the annual reporting process.
  • Strategic & Operational Support
  • Partner with the CEO to provide financial insights, modeling, and performance analysis that support strategic and operational decision-making.
  • Support business planning, cost analysis, and margin optimization.
  • Provide ad hoc financial reporting and analysis to support strategic initiatives.
  • Finance Technology & Systems
  • Oversee accounting and finance-related software tools.
  • Collaborate on implementation and integration of systems to support automation and visibility.
  • People Operations & Systems
  • Oversee and maintain the company's HR platform (Rise), ensuring accuracy across payroll, benefits, onboarding, and offboarding.
  • Coordinate benefits enrollment, changes, and terminations with providers.
  • Support compliance-related documentation, reporting, and record-keeping tied to employee data and compensation.
  • Partner with the CEO and external advisors on government grants, reporting, and people-related financial administration.


You may be a fit for this role if you have
  • CPA designation with 5+ years of progressive accounting and finance experience, ideally within a growing business; experience in a digital marketing or professional services environment is an asset.
  • Proven experience managing full-cycle accounting operations and financial reporting in a hands-on capacity.
  • In-depth understanding of financial statements, budgeting, forecasting, and tax compliance.
  • Ability to analyze complex financial data and translate it into clear, actionable insights for non-financial stakeholders.
  • Proficiency with QuickBooks Online, advanced Excel/Google Sheets skills, and other supplementary reporting tools.
  • High attention to detail, strong organizational skills, and a proactive, analytical mindset.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ills; comfortable working cross-functionally.
  • Demonstrated ability to take ownership of a finance function and, over time, help shape and build a finance team as the company scales.


Success in This Role Looks Like
  • You don't just report what happened-you help stakeholders understand what the numbers mean and how they should influence decisions.
  • You invest time in understanding how the business operates, connecting financial outcomes to operational and strategic drivers.
  • You ensure that there is a solid foundation of reliability and accuracy in the financial results due to strong internal controls, high culture of integrity, and discipline in finance processes.
  • You act as a financial thought partner to the CEO and leadership team, bringing clarity, discipline, and insight to planning and decision-making.
  • You understand how the company's core systems and technologies connect across the business and partner with the leadership team to ensure data integrity, system alignment, and timely, accurate information that supports strong, informed decision-making.
